Hermès, the iconic French luxury goods manufacturer, is synonymous with unparalleled craftsmanship, timeless elegance, and exclusivity. But beyond the meticulously crafted handbags and silk scarves lies a fascinating story of family ownership and enduring legacy. The answer to the question, "Is Hermès family owned?" is a resounding yes. The company remains firmly under the control of the descendants of Thierry Hermès, forming one of the world's wealthiest and most influential family dynasties. This article delves into the intricate details of the Hermès family, their continued stewardship of the brand, their net worth, the brands they own, and dispels any misconceptions about ownership of other entities often confused with the luxury house.

The Hermès Family: A Legacy of Luxury

The story of Hermès begins in 1837 with Thierry Hermès, a harness maker who established a workshop in Paris specializing in high-quality saddles and harnesses for carriages. His meticulous craftsmanship and dedication to quality laid the foundation for the luxury empire that would follow. Over the generations, the family has carefully nurtured the brand, expanding its offerings to include a vast array of luxury goods while maintaining its commitment to exceptional quality and traditional techniques. Today, the company's success is a testament to the family's unwavering vision and dedication.

The family's ownership structure is complex, involving a network of trusts and holding companies designed to protect the brand's independence and long-term vision. While precise details of the family's internal structure remain largely private, it's understood that a significant portion of the voting rights remains concentrated within the family, ensuring their continued control. This careful management has prevented hostile takeovers and preserved the brand's unique identity and heritage. The family's commitment to maintaining control is a key factor in Hermès' continued success and enduring appeal.

Brands Owned by Hermès:

Hermès' portfolio extends far beyond its iconic handbags. The brand encompasses a diverse range of luxury goods, all reflecting the same commitment to quality, craftsmanship, and timeless design. These include:

* Leather Goods: This is undoubtedly the most recognizable segment, featuring the coveted Birkin and Kelly bags, along with a wide array of smaller leather goods, wallets, belts, and luggage.

* Ready-to-Wear: Hermès offers a sophisticated and elegant ready-to-wear collection for both men and women, featuring classic silhouettes and luxurious fabrics.

* Silk Scarves (Carrés): The Hermès silk scarf is a legendary piece of art, known for its intricate designs and luxurious feel.

* Watches: Hermès produces a range of high-end watches, combining horological expertise with the brand's signature aesthetic.

* Home Goods: This category includes tableware, textiles, and other home accessories, all reflecting the brand's commitment to quality and design.

* Perfumes: Hermès perfumes are known for their sophisticated and timeless fragrances, reflecting the brand's overall aesthetic.
